Now he does give us a hint, though how he does that now and show some goodness in our difficult experiences. Go with me to James chapter 1 James chapter 1 and verse two James one verse two says this, consider it all joy, my brother. When your life stinks 27th.

So when you encounter various trials, and by the way, you will encounter various trials, you will find pain-and-suffering part of living and you know why your center.

Everyone you know is a center and a planet is cursed.

Okay you know what that means. Horrible things happen they happen since the gardener going to happen until he comes back there going to happen. Horrible, terrible things are going to happen because of trials. You see, that's what's going to happen, so expect that he said us is the way it's going to be. But notice, consider all joy when you encounter various trials, knowing that the testing of your faith. What got to see what God does. He said I can even tempt someone evil, or to bad I can even do that but I can tell you every terrible trial comes in your life from God's point of view is what test what you testing my faith is testing my faith everything is terrible happens. You see in the test is simply this, you trust me or not. Should you trust me or not. That's the test and see often. We need to be tested. Not so that God knows where we are spiritually. But so we know where we are spiritually and so when you go to really hard things. It's so easy to fail the test maker just see how difficult this would be for us. Even people close the site was right on the lake right big storm comes up and what they do, they wake Jesus up, say don't you care that were perishing enough. You see, and what he say he still you men of little faith, said total going to the other shore. That means were going on God and you started panicking because you saw the wind and the waves you can trust me see what happens us all the time it in the test hasn't a profound effect on us.

Watch, knowing that the testing your faith produces endurance.

By way what you need to live as a sinner in a cursed world endurance.

That's what you need only need from just how about this what you need to be a good parent. Yeah, relentless endurance. That's what it takes, and he says it'll create endurance and met endurance have its perfect result that you may be perfect and complete, lacking in nothing that were complete telling us means chore.

So what happens in trials. If I trust the Lord. What happens to me. I mature and become more conformed to the image of Christ.

Why it's of sin go with me now to first Corinthians 15 first Corinthians 15 no notice but Paul writes the Corinthians 51 verse 51 behold, I tell you a mystery. We will not all sleep, but will all be changed. Now this is talking about the second coming of the rapture. We might obviously body but were all in a change if the rapture occurs right now I'm to be with the Lord so you my body mopey at this point this place got be changed. He then goes on in a moment, in the twinkling of an eye. The last trumpet, the temple sound and the dead will be raised imperishable, and will be changed for this perishable must put on the imperishable. This mortal must put on immortality. But when the perishable will put on the imperishable, and this mortal will put on immortality, then will come about the saying that is written is swallowed up in victory over death, where is your victory over death, where is your sting. The sting of death is sin, and the power of sin is the law thanks be to God who gives us the victory through our Lord Jesus Christ is no sting in my death only victory that's the way it is. You see, Jesus goes out of his way to let us know that there's nothing to fear here want to think of the eternal state. Are any of our bodies going to be an eternal state. No person is this world going to be in the eternal state. No new heaven and new earth. Why is world cursed so this world and these bodies will never make it to the eternal state. But you and I will make it not be a new heaven and new earth. He says I got this I'm going to do this for you even your death will be a good thing then number eight.
